Which of the given options would be a logical sequence of the following places when arranged in a logical sequence from outside to inside?

1. School.

2. Blocks.

3. Student.

4. Class.


1. 2, 1, 3, 4
2. 1, 2, 4, 3
3. 1, 2, 3, 4
4. 2, 3, 1, 4

Correct Answer - Option 2 : 1, 2, 4, 3

The relationship given here is of School and its inner parts.

First comes School, having different Blocks.

Then the classrooms In the blocks and then the students studying in classes.

The correct order is,

School (1) → Blocks (2) → Classrooms (4) → Students (3).

Hence, the correct answer is "Option 2".
